难治性癫痫中乙酰胆碱能神经元的病变

Lesions of acetylcholine neurons in refractory epilepsy.

Abstract

We have examined brainstem lesions in patients with refractory epilepsy disorders, including West syndrome (WS), Lennox-Gastaut syndrome (LGS), and dentatorubral-pallidoluysian atrophy (DRPLA). Acetylcholinergic neurons (AchNs) in the pedunculopontine tegmental nucleus (PPN) are involved in mental development, and disruption of neuronal nicotinic acetylcholine receptors can lead to epilepsy. In order to investigate the involvement of lesions of AchNs in refractory epilepsy, we performed immunohistochemical analyses of AchNs in the PPN in autopsy cases who had a past history of WS and/or LGS and in DRPLA cases who showed progressive myoclonic epilepsy. In addition, we performed a preliminary quantification of the levels of acetylcholine, neuropeptides, and monoamine metabolites in the cerebrospinal fluid (CSF) of patients with WS and benign convulsions associated with mild gastroenteritis (CwG). In the PPN analysis, the total number of neurons and the number of AchNs were reduced in WS/LGS and WS cases, while DRPLA cases showed a decrease in the number and percentage of AchNs. In the CSF analysis, WS patients demonstrated a reduction in the levels of inhibitory neuropeptides, while CwG patients showed increased levels of acetylcholine and decreased levels of serotonin metabolites. These data suggest the possible involvement of lesions of AchNs in WS and DRPLA.

摘要

我们检查了难治性癫痫疾病患者的脑干病变,这些疾病包括韦斯特综合征(WS)、伦诺克斯 - 加斯托综合征(LGS)和齿状核红核苍白球路易体萎缩症(DRPLA)。脚桥被盖核(PPN)中的乙酰胆碱能神经元(AchNs)参与智力发育,神经元烟碱型乙酰胆碱受体的破坏可导致癫痫。为了研究AchNs病变在难治性癫痫中的作用,我们对有WS和/或LGS病史的尸检病例以及表现为进行性肌阵挛癫痫的DRPLA病例的PPN中的AchNs进行了免疫组织化学分析。此外,我们对WS患者和与轻度胃肠炎相关的良性惊厥(CwG)患者脑脊液(CSF)中的乙酰胆碱、神经肽和单胺代谢物水平进行了初步定量。在PPN分析中,WS/LGS和WS病例中神经元总数和AchNs数量减少,而DRPLA病例中AchNs数量和百分比下降。在CSF分析中,WS患者的抑制性神经肽水平降低,而CwG患者的乙酰胆碱水平升高,血清素代谢物水平降低。这些数据表明AchNs病变可能与WS和DRPLA有关。
